Understanding Stage 2 Hair Loss

The Norwood scale is used to measure hair loss in men, while the Ludwig scale is used in women. Stage 2 hair loss condition among men is characterised by primary hairline recession, especially around the temples on the scalp. On the contrary, among women, stage 2 hair loss is widely observed when there is slow hair thinning across the crown area and broadening of the hair parting.

Stage 2 hair loss is an intermediate phase where notable damage has been done, but there is an opportunity for recovery with hair stabilisation and regrowth.   1. Diagnosing The Cause Of Stage 2 Hair Loss

Stage 2 hair loss can occur for multiple reasons.

  • Hereditary condition
  • Stress-induced inadequate lifestyle
  • Hormonal imbalance
  • Disproportionate nutrition
  • Medication

Accurate diagnosis is important before starting any treatment. Trichologists or hair transplantation experts begin by examining the scalp, analysing follicular health and conducting blood tests to identify any deficiency or hormonal imbalance.   1. Topical Treatments And Medications

An FDA-sanctioned topical treatment, Minoxidil, is often recommended to treat stage 2 hair loss. It has various strengths like enhancing blood circulation to the follicles, stimulating hair growth and making inactive hair follicles and cells work diligently. Finasteride is a commonly prescribed medicine that reduces DHT hormone production, which is responsible for follicle shrinkage. With the reduction of  DHT hormone production, finasteride medicine helps to cure stage 2 hair loss and promote hair regrowth. The two most convenient advantages of this medication are that it is effective in preventing stage 2 hair loss and is very convenient for oral treatment.

  1. Incorporating PRP Treatment

PRP or Platelet Rich Therapy is a noteworthy non-surgical treatment that has proven its effectiveness for stage 2 hair loss recovery. The PRP therapy involves taking blood from the patient, concentrating the platelets and injecting them into the affected area of the scalp. The reason that PRP treatment works is that platelets within the blood have growth factors to stimulate inactive hair follicles and improve their thickness and strength.   1. Considering Lllt Treatment

LLLT, or lower-level laser therapy, is an efficient treatment for stage 2 hair loss. It has been a prominent solution to cure androgenetic alopecia and also for pattern baldness among males and females. It increases the circulation to the scalp so that adequate nutrients and oxygen can be delivered to hair follicles to stimulate hair growth. The LLLT therapy alleviates scalp inflammation around hair follicles, contributing to stopping stage 2 hair loss. Like Finasteride, it also reduces the negative effects of the dihydrotestosterone hormone.

  1. Microneedling For Hair Regrowth

Microneedling is an effective treatment for stage 2 hair loss conditions. It is mainly effective for androgenetic alopecia, a baldness pattern for both males and females. In the microneedling treatment, small microinjuries are applied to the scalp through surgical needles that trigger the natural wound healing response of the body. It increases blood flow and produces collagen to enhance inactive hair follicles. This method improves the effectiveness of topical hair loss medications like Minoxidil.

  1. Including Nutritional Hair Boosting Food And Supplements

Collagen and amino acid-based food supplements are highly effective for restricting stage 2 hair loss and encouraging hair regrowth. Collagen is a common protein that can be found within hair that has been created from amino acids like glycine, lysine and proline. So, consume these foods and nutritional supplements to improve follicle structure and focus on scalp elasticity. Vitamin C is an ideal nutritional supplement to improve hair health. Some essential nutrient supplements are biotin, vitamin D, Iron, Zinc, omega-3 fatty acids and protein help in increasing hair health. However, most importantly, always seek a doctor’s recommendation before consumption.

In terms of mental condition, prolonged stress can be responsible for stage 2 hair loss. There is a possibility of developing Telogen effluvium because of stress. It is a non-permanent hair loss condition where hair follicles are induced within the telogen phase or resting phase, determining cell damage. In this scenario, incorporating stress-reducing techniques like yoga and meditation, exercise, and an adequate sleep hygiene routine is essential to support your ongoing treatments and medications for better results.
